RMS ST HELENA IN DRY DOCK

Repair work on the RMS St Helena is progressing well in the Dry Dock at Simonstown.

The damaged control rod for the Starboard controllable pitch propeller has been exposed and repair work is ongoing.  The starboard propeller shaft has been withdrawn as part of the repair operation (see photo attached).

While in Dry Dock, the RMS’ hull will be thoroughly cleaned.  An inspection will also be carried out of all underwater equipment including the ship’s stabilisers.

While no guarantee can be given until repairs and testing are complete, it is expected that the RMS should be back in service as planned for her next voyage, departing Cape Town on Friday, 14 April 2017.
